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9003398529 588911 78
38572 208722 84654016
38572 208722 84654016
78176225564 9458 1316885
All about undefined
Interested in learning more?
38572 208722 84654016
78176225564 9458 1316885
See more
4149 9266140
5218074 79091510 93676824039
See more
871 43042 68
75 4751060859 682405019
See more